Weather-Responsive Watering



Weather-responsive watering systems utilize clever climate sensors to maximize watering routines based on existing ecological conditions. These systems consist of rain hold-up functionality, which prevents unnecessary watering throughout damp weather, and seasonal changes that tailor water use to differing environment patterns. As a result, they boost water performance and advertise much healthier landscapes.

 

 

 

Smart Climate Sensors



Smart weather sensors have actually revolutionized the performance of modern watering systems by readjusting watering schedules based on real-time ecological information. These sensing units check variables such as temperature level, moisture, wind rate, and solar radiation, permitting systems to react dynamically to altering climate condition. By incorporating this information, wise sensors can maximize water use, lowering waste and guaranteeing that landscapes obtain the suitable quantity of dampness. This modern technology not just preserves water but likewise advertises much healthier plant growth by avoiding overwatering or underwatering. Additionally, the automation offered by smart climate sensing units boosts customer ease, as landscaping companies and home owners can depend on exact watering timetables without hand-operated intervention. Overall, these innovations stand for a substantial advancement in sustainable irrigation methods.

Dirt Dampness Sensors



Dirt dampness sensors play a crucial role in contemporary watering systems, offering real-time information that enhances water efficiency. These devices measure the volumetric water content in the soil, enabling accurate analyses of dampness levels. By integrating soil dampness sensing units into irrigation systems, customers can prevent overwatering or underwatering, inevitably promoting healthier plant development and saving water resources.The sensors transmit information to controllers, which can readjust sprinkling timetables based upon existing soil problems. This data-driven strategy decreases water waste and assurances that plants get the most effective quantity of wetness. In addition, soil dampness sensing units can be valuable in various farming setups, from home yards to large-scale farms. The deployment of these sensing units contributes to lasting techniques by sustaining responsible water use and minimizing environmental influence. On the whole, the unification of soil dampness sensors notes a substantial development in achieving efficient watering systems.
